Abstract· Keywords

Report Errors
The purpose of this study is to examine the longitudinal changes of maternal depression for 8 years, after birth till the children become 8 years old, using latent growth modeling. This study also investigated whether marital relationship satisfaction influenced the change trajectories of maternal depression and whether the change trajectories of maternal depression impacted the children’s internalizing and externalizing problem behaviors. The data from the Panel Study on Korean Children (PSKC) were used (from the 1st year to 8th year). The results showed that the change trajectory of maternal depression was significant. Maternal depression decreased for 8 years after child’s birth. Marital relationship satisfaction of mothers influenced the intercept and slope of the depression change trajectory. This change trajectory of decreasing maternal depression influenced the internalizing and externalizing behaviors of their children. Based on these results, implications for parent education, family education, and family counseling and therapy, and future research directions are discussed.
